Harald Notini Böhlmarks Model 225 Floor Lamp 1940s
A floor lamp designed by Harald Notini for Böhlmarks Lampfabrik, Stockholm. Model 225, stamped P225 to the base, is a precise architectural form: a slender column rising from a weighted circular base, topped by a conical shade with a pleated interior and adjustable on an original brass gooseneck. The coiled brass neck has developed a warm, even patina over its lifetime and contrasts quietly with the re-lacquered body.
The lamp has been re-lacquered in a matt Grey White, a warm off-white with a cool grey undertone widely used in modernist architecture and industrial design. The matt finish brings a considered restraint to the restoration.
Updated with new electrics throughout: twisted fabric cord, bakelite E27 fitting, EU plug, and floor switch. Ready to use.

Details
- Designer: Harald Notini (1879–1959)
- Manufacturer: Böhlmarks Lampfabrik, Stockholm
- Model: 225 (stamped P225)
- Period: 1930s–40s
- Materials: Re-lacquered metal in Grey White (matt); original patinated brass gooseneck
- Updated electrics: twisted fabric cord, bakelite E27 fitting, EU plug, and switch
- Dimensions: H approx. 140cm (H approx. 55.1")
- Condition: Restored; newly re-lacquered; updated electrics
